Transitioning from Crib to Toddler Bed
Transitioning from crib to toddler bed is seamless with the 4-in-1 crib’s convertible design. To begin, lower the crib to its minimum height setting for safety. Remove the front rail and attach the toddler rail using the provided Allen-head bolts. Ensure all connections are secure and tighten firmly. Double-check the stability of the bed before allowing your child to use it. This transition marks an exciting milestone, offering your child independence while maintaining a familiar sleeping environment. Always follow the manual’s specific instructions for a smooth and safe conversion. Proper assembly ensures the bed remains sturdy and secure for your growing toddler.

Secure all bolts tightly to prevent loose parts. Inspect regularly for stability and security. Always follow the instructions carefully to ensure the crib is assembled and used correctly. Avoid using abrasive cleaners or window cleaners, as they may damage the surface. Never add pillows, comforters, or extra padding, as this can pose a suffocation risk. Keep loose clothing and small parts secure to prevent entanglement or choking hazards. Regularly inspect the crib for loose fasteners or instability. Adult supervision is required during assembly and use. Small parts may pose a choking hazard before assembly. Do not use the crib if you cannot follow the instructions precisely. If the height adjustment mechanism on your 4-in-1 crib is not functioning properly, first ensure all fasteners are tightened securely. Check for any obstructions or misaligned parts that may hinder smooth adjustment. If the issue persists, inspect the adjustment levers or handles for damage. Lubricate moving parts with a silicone-based spray if they feel stiff. Avoid using excessive force, as this could damage the mechanism. If the problem remains unresolved, contact the manufacturer for replacement parts or further assistance. Maintain a routine inspection schedule for optimal crib performance. To maintain cleanliness and safety, regularly clean the crib surface using a mild soap solution and a soft, damp cloth. Avoid harsh chemicals, abrasive cleaners, or bleach, as they may damage the finish or harm your child. Gently wipe down all surfaces, paying attention to areas around joints and crevices where dust may accumulate. For stubborn stains, lightly scrub with a soft-bristle brush. Ensure the crib is completely dry after cleaning to prevent moisture buildup. Never use window cleaners or aerosol products, as they can leave harmful residues. For polished or painted surfaces, a damp cloth is sufficient. Cleaning regularly helps maintain a safe and hygienic environment for your child.
